Beefy Noodle Casserole

A beefy, tangy casserole for a hearty dinner on a budget.

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Servings 8

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 3 8 ounce cans tomato sauce
  • 1 Tablespoon s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/8 te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 16 ounce bag wide egg noodles
  • 1 tablespoon dried parsley
  • 1 cup cottage cheese
  • 1 8 ounce package cream cheese softened
  • 1/4 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up shredded Parmesan cheese

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350 F. Cook the onion, minced garlic, and ground beef together until all the pink is gone and beef crumbles, drain off excess fat. Start boiling water for the noodles.
  • Add the tomato sauce, sugar, garlic powder, red pepper flakes, Italian seasoning, salt and pepper. Combine and simmer over low heat.
  • Cook the egg noodles per package directions.
  • Mix together the cooked noodles, cottage cheese, sour cream, softened cream cheese and dried parsley.
  • Spread half the noodle mixture into a greased 13x9 baking dish, layer with meat mixture. Repeat both layers and top with shredded Parmesan cheese.
  • Bake for 30 minutes in a 350 F oven.

Notes

This casserole can be made ahead of time and either refrigerate or freeze for later.
